The Free Cloud Alliance publishes Guidlines as a way to to help clients of Cloud Computing solutions assess their software vendors and service providers based on tangible facts rather than on marketing materials.

  • Are you Free to Leave ?: Cloud Computing is definitely a fantastic way to save costs... until one gets trapped by vendor lock-in. The "Total Information Outsoucing" guidelines, based on research conducted since 2008 by a group of internation experts under the guidance of FFII, can be used to assess Cloud Computing vendors in terms of transparency, security, revertability commitment.
  • Do you Believe in Freedom ?: some software vendors use the words "Open Source" extensively to promote their solutions, yet run their own business with proprietary solutions. The "Software Freedom Values" assessment guidelines will help you determine whether a given vendor uses the words "Open Source" because of a strong belief in Open Source technologies or only as a way to sound fashionable.
